Is filtered water 100% safe?

Filtered water is generally considered safe for consumption, but it is not 100% free of all contaminants. While filtration systems effectively remove many impurities, no method can guarantee complete elimination of all potential hazards. Understanding the limitations and benefits of different filtration systems can help ensure safer drinking water.

What Are the Benefits of Filtered Water?

Filtered water offers several advantages, making it a preferred choice for many households. Here’s why:

  • Improved Taste and Odor: Filtration removes chlorine, sediment, and other impurities that can affect the taste and smell of tap water.
  • Reduced Contaminants: Most filters can effectively reduce heavy metals like lead, as well as bacteria, parasites, and chemicals.
  • Cost-Effective: Compared to bottled water, using a home filtration system can save money over time.
  • Environmental Impact: Reducing reliance on bottled water decreases plastic waste.

These benefits make filtered water an attractive option for those seeking to improve their water quality.

How Do Different Filtration Systems Work?

Understanding how different filtration systems work can help you choose the best option for your needs. Here’s a comparison of common systems:

Feature Activated Carbon Filters Reverse Osmosis Systems Distillation Units
Contaminants Removed Chlorine, VOCs, some heavy metals Most contaminants, including fluoride Bacteria, viruses, heavy metals
Cost Low to moderate Moderate to high Moderate
Maintenance Regular filter replacement Requires membrane replacement Regular cleaning
Water Waste None Produces wastewater None

Activated Carbon Filters

Activated carbon filters are popular for their ability to remove chlorine, volatile organic compounds (VOCs), and some heavy metals. They work by adsorption, where contaminants stick to the carbon surface. These filters are affordable and easy to maintain, making them a common choice for households.

Reverse Osmosis Systems

Reverse osmosis (RO) systems are highly effective at removing a broad range of contaminants, including fluoride, nitrates, and heavy metals. They use a semipermeable membrane to separate impurities from the water. However, RO systems can be costly and produce wastewater, which may not be ideal for all users.

Distillation Units

Distillation units purify water by boiling it and then condensing the steam back into liquid form, leaving most contaminants behind. This method effectively removes bacteria, viruses, and heavy metals. While distillation is thorough, it can be energy-intensive and slow.

Is Filtered Water 100% Safe?

While filtered water is significantly safer than unfiltered tap water, it is not 100% free from all contaminants. Here’s why:

  • Filter Limitations: No single filtration method can remove every type of contaminant. Combining methods, such as using both activated carbon and reverse osmosis, can improve results.
  • Maintenance: Regular maintenance is crucial. Failing to replace filters or membranes can reduce effectiveness and potentially introduce contaminants.
  • Source Water Quality: The quality of the source water affects the final product. In areas with highly contaminated water, even filtered water may not meet safety standards.

How to Ensure Safe Filtered Water?

To maximize the safety of your filtered water, consider these tips:

  • Regular Maintenance: Follow the manufacturer’s guidelines for replacing filters and cleaning systems.
  • Test Water Quality: Periodically test your water to ensure the filtration system is working effectively.
  • Choose Certified Products: Look for filters certified by organizations like NSF International, which test for specific contaminant removal.

What Contaminants Do Water Filters Not Remove?

Most filters do not remove all microorganisms, such as viruses, and some chemicals like pesticides. It’s important to choose a filter designed for the specific contaminants present in your water.

How Often Should I Change My Water Filter?

The frequency of changing your water filter depends on the type and usage. Generally, it’s recommended to replace filters every 2-6 months, but always refer to the manufacturer’s instructions.

Can I Use Filtered Water for Cooking?

Yes, using filtered water for cooking can improve the taste of food and beverages and reduce exposure to contaminants.

Are There Any Health Risks Associated with Filtered Water?

Filtered water is generally safe, but improper maintenance can lead to bacterial growth in the filter. Regularly replacing filters and cleaning systems mitigates this risk.

What Is the Best Water Filter for Home Use?

The best filter depends on your specific needs. For general use, a combination of activated carbon and reverse osmosis systems offers comprehensive filtration.
